Total-Text-Dataset

Total-Text-Dataset

55%

Total-Text-Dataset is a comprehensive, word-level based English curve text dataset designed to facilitate research in text detection and recognition. It comprises 1555 images featuring more than three different text orientations: horizontal, multi-oriented, and curved, making it unique among existing datasets. The dataset is regularly updated with detection and recognition leaderboards, showcasing the performance of various methods. It also provides an updated guided annotation toolbox for scene text image annotation and includes pixel-level and text-level ground truth data. Researchers can leverage this dataset for training and benchmarking models, particularly for arbitrary-shaped text reading tasks, and it has been extended into the larger ArT dataset.

stardist

stardist

55%

StarDist is an open-source Python implementation for object detection and segmentation using star-convex shapes in 2D and 3D images. It is particularly well-suited for applications in microscopy and histopathology, enabling precise cell and nuclei instance segmentation. The tool trains models to predict distances to object boundaries and probabilities, generating candidate polygons that are refined via non-maximum suppression. StarDist supports multi-class prediction, allowing objects to be classified into discrete categories. It also includes a submodule for computing common instance segmentation metrics, facilitating performance evaluation. Installation is straightforward with pip, and pretrained models are available for various image types.

tstorage

tstorage

55%

tstorage is a lightweight, open-source, embedded time-series database designed for efficient handling of large volumes of time-series data. It features a straightforward API with massively optimized ingestion capabilities, ensuring goroutine-safe writes and reads. The database partitions data points by time, using a linear data model structure rather than B-trees or LSM trees, which is ideal for time-series workloads that are mostly append-only. It supports both in-memory and persistent disk storage, allowing users to specify a data path for on-disk persistence. tstorage also handles out-of-order data points by buffering them in memory partitions, making it robust against network latency or clock synchronization issues. This design ensures fast read operations, especially for recent data, and efficient storage by sequentially writing larger files when partitions are full.
